Installation on a VPS
VPS (virtual private server) hosting is a natural next step for web owners who have exhausted the resources of a shared web host. This type of hosting uses hypervisor, which is a software program that divides a physical server into virtual compartments (VMs) that each have their own OS. Each VM is like an individual computer that has its own hardware memory, storage space and memory which the user has access to and manage. This type of hosting offers greater flexibility, visibility and workload control than shared hosts.
A VPS could be an ideal choice for web owners who wish to test out new server configurations and applications, but don't yet have the budget for a dedicated server. The setup is more technical than a shared or cloud plan, however a wealth of tutorials are online. This type of hosting is best suited for website owners who require more security and performance than a shared server and for those with a solid understanding of the management of servers.
Another good reason to use the VPS is to serve as an backup plan in case of emergency. A VPS can be a great way to avoid costly downtime caused by resource overload if you are dealing with many users.
VPS hosts can scale their servers to meet the need, unlike shared hosting where every time a website exceeds the resources of the server and has a negative impact on other websites that are on the same server. This is a great option for eCommerce websites, SaaS providers and agencies who have multiple websites.
